Title: The Innovative Contributions of Cedric Calberg
Introduction: Cedric Calberg, an inventor based in Liege, Belgium, has made notable strides in the field of electropolymerization with his two patented inventions. His work primarily focuses on methods that enhance the deposition of films on electrically conductive surfaces, reflecting his commitment to advancing materials science.
Latest Patents: Cedric Calberg holds two patents that showcase his innovative approaches to electropolymerization. The first patent involves a process for depositing a composite film through electropolymerization onto an electrically conductive surface. This method utilizes a mixture of a monomer, a dopant-forming substance, a supporting electrolyte, and a solvent undergoing electrolysis, where the conductive surface serves as either the cathode or anode. The second patent describes a similar process for depositing an organic film on an electrically conductive surface. This method employs a mixture containing a monomer, a linking material, a supporting electrolyte, and a solvent, enhancing the interactivity of the growing polymeric chains.
